Academic Education
Year | Degree | University | Field of study |
---|---|---|---|
2004 | Teaching certificate (Lehrzertifikat) | Ruprecht-Karls-Universität, Heidelberg | Zellbiology |
1993 – 1996 | Ph.D. (Magna cum laude) | Johannes-Gutenberg University, Mainz; MPI for Brain Research, Frankfurt/M. | Neurobiology |
1992 – 1993 | Diploma | Johannes-Gutenberg University, Mainz; MPI for Brain Research, Frankfurt/M. | Biology |
1988 – 1992 | Undergraduate studies | Johannes-Gutenberg University, Mainz | Biology |
Professional Experience
Period | Institution | Position | Discipline |
---|---|---|---|
2009 - | Eberhard-Karls-University Tübingen, | CIN-Professor | Ophthalmic Research |
2009 | Offered a professorship (W3) at the University of Heidelberg | ||
2007 | Offered a professorship (W2) at the University of Erlangen-Nürnberg | ||
2006 – 2009 | Dept. of Biomedical Optics, MPI for Medical Research Heidelberg | Research group leader | Neuroscience |
2007 – 2009 | Member of the IZN (Interdisciplinary Center for Neurosciences) Ruprecht-Karls-Universität, Heidelberg | ||
2000 – 2006 | Dept. of Biomedical Optics MPI for Medical Research, Heidelberg | Research fellow | Neuroscience |
1997 – 2000 | Harvard Medical School; Massachusetts General Hospital, Boston, MA, USA | Post-Doctoral fellow | Neuroscience |
1996 – 1996 | Dept. for Neuroanatomy, Max-Planck Institute for Brain Research, Frankfurt/M. | Post-Doctoral Fellow | Neuroscience |
